Metis.Uma ferramenta para particionar gráficos, malhas e redutores não estruturados, reduzindo as ordens de matrizes esparsas | |
Baixe Agora |
Metis. Classificação e resumo
Propaganda
- Licença:
- Freeware
- Preço:
- FREE
- Nome do editor:
- METIS Team
- Site do editor:
- http://glaros.dtc.umn.edu/gkhome/metis/metis/overview
- Sistemas operacionais:
- Mac OS X
- Tamanho do arquivo:
- 496 KB
Metis. Tag
Metis. Descrição
Uma ferramenta para particionar gráficos, malhas e redutores de computação de compilação de matrizes esparsas O METIS é um conjunto de programas seriais para particionar gráficos, particionamento de malhas de elementos finitos e produzindo pedidos de redução de preenchimento para matrizes esparsas. Os algoritmos implementados em METIs são baseados nos esquemas de particionamento de bisseação multilível-bissection, multinível e multi-restrições desenvolvidos em nosso Lab.Metis estão sendo desenvolvidos inteiramente na ANSI C e, portanto, portáteis na maioria dos sistemas UNIX que têm O compilador ANSI C (o compilador GNU C fará) .metis foi extensivamente testado em AIX, Sun OS, Solaris, Irix, Linux, HP-UX, BSD e UNICOS. Aqui estão algumas características principais de "Metis": Fornece partições de alta qualidade: · Experimentos em um grande número de gráficos que surgem em vários domínios, incluindo métodos de elementos finitos, programação linear, VLSI e transporte mostram que Metis produz partições que são consistentemente melhores do que as produzidas por outros algoritmos amplamente utilizados. As partições produzidas por metis são consistentemente 10% a 50% melhores do que as produzidas por algoritmos de particionamento espectral. É extremamente rápido: · Experiências em uma ampla gama de gráficos mostrou que a metis é uma a duas ordens de magnitude mais rápida do que outros algoritmos de particionamento amplamente utilizados. Gráficos com mais de 1.000.000 vértices podem ser particionados em 256 partes em poucos segundos em estações de trabalho e PCs de geração atuais. Produz encomendas baixas: · As ordens de redução de preenchimento produzidas por metis são significativamente melhores do que as produzidas por outros algoritmos amplamente utilizados, incluindo múltiplos grau mínimo. Para muitas classes de problemas decorrentes de cálculos científicos e programação linear, a Metis é capaz de reduzir os requisitos de armazenamento e computacional da fatoração de matriz esparsa, até uma ordem de magnitude. Além disso, ao contrário de múltiplos grau mínimo, as árvores de eliminação produzidas por metis são adequadas para factorização direta paralela. Além disso, Metis é capaz de calcular essas ordenações muito rápidas. Matrizes com mais de 200.000 linhas podem ser reordenadas em apenas alguns segundos nas estações de trabalho e PCs de geração atuais. O que há de novo nesta versão: · Corrigido alguns bugs nas rotinas de particionamento multi-restrição · Corrigido alguns bugs nas rotinas de minimização de volume
Metis. Software Relacionado